Extra-cursory books suitable for high school students

1 answer
2024-09-15 11:13

High school students can refer to the following suggestions when reading extra-cursory books: 1.One Hundred Years of Solitude by Garcia Marquez: This is a magical realism novel that tells the story of a family of seven generations and profoundly reveals the history and fate of the people of Latin-America. 2 Harry Potter JK Rowling: This is a novel about the magical world. It tells the story of a young Harry Potter growing up at Hogwarts School of Witchcraft and Wizardry, allowing readers to experience the wonders and adventures of the magical world. 3 The Great Gatsby, F. Scott F. Gerald: This is a literary work describing American society in the 1920s. Through the love story of Gatsby and Daisy, it reveals the social class and wealth gap at that time. 4 " Three-body " Liu Cixin: This is a science fiction novel about the communication and conflict between humans and alien civilizations. It also explored the future of mankind and the mysteries of the universe. 5 " Ordinary World " Lu Yao: This is a novel describing the life and fate of Chinese rural people. Through telling the story of Sun Shao 'an and Sun Shaoping, it shows the changes of Chinese rural society and the complexity of human nature. These novels had profound thoughts and unique artistic styles that could inspire readers 'thinking and imagination. At the same time, they were also suitable for high school students to read and discuss. Of course, different readers could choose books that suited them according to their interests and reading level.
